Output 3104460c94c05594758114a4641dcc3a7ffa641ae098d7cd64b24b542b377f07:8

value
22000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30a5811782bf934eec3fe9132eff32590216ca7a OP_EQUALVERIFY OP_CHECKSIG
address
15SDheTSWyZS4MuQATTKe8Pr6D2zL8kcQ4
transaction
3104460c94c05594758114a4641dcc3a7ffa641ae098d7cd64b24b542b377f07
spent
true